PROJECT-1: FINAL YEAR ENGINEERING PROJECT
Title: Biomedical energy harvesting using helical configuration.
Team Size: 2
Skills used: MATLAB, PYTHON, ARDUINO IDE, PROTEUS
Project Description:
Independent pacemaker prototype model for explaining the working of artificial pacemaker of PVDF self rechargeable pacemaker, which can be divided into two parts. One is a pacemaker attached to the body, and the other is a part drawn in Python. Parts of the pacemaker include a vibrator, piezo polymer, Arduino UNO, a Bluetooth module, a battery, and a charging circuit.
Vibrators are used to simulate a heartbeat. Piezoelectric polymers are placed in different positions of the heart (vibrator) along the heart (functional vibrator), and the electric current is generated by the piezoelectric polymer through vibration.
This electrical impulse is amplified by a very efficient charging circuit and converted to battery charging voltage. The battery continues to charge according to this scheme, increasing the efficiency of the system.
A microcontroller connected to this system is used to collect the voltage generated by the piezoelectric film. The data which is sent from the microcontroller terminal to Bluetooth module will be seen in PC. To get the signals on PC, we are connecting a USB converter in between PC and Bluetooth. After receiving the data by PC, we are using an AIMBAT simulation tool for data plotting and visualization by using python language.
PROJECT-2: 3rd YEAR ENGINEERING MINI-PROJECT
Title: Predictive model for urine analysis system for early detection of CKD by AI.
Team Size: 3
Skills used: AI algorithm, ARDUINO IDE
Project Description:
The goal of the project is to implement an easy, cost-effective method to screen a population with asymptomatic chronic kidney disease and initiate therapy to reduce the risk of cardiovascular events and end-stage renal disease in an outreach camp setting. To achieve this we will be using Urine test strips, the color sensor (TCS3200) interfaced with a microcontroller and an Arduino board. The proposed system is able to detect the change in color in the urine strips, which is indicative of albuminuria content in urine. The sensor values are transferred to the mobile application using a Bluetooth module.
